Sourcing guidance for Dry Cleaning Pressing Machine

What are the key technical specifications to consider when selecting a dry cleaning pressing machine?

When evaluating a pressing machine, prioritize the heating method (steam, electric, or oil-heated) and the buck (pressing head) shape, which must match the garment type (e.g., utility, mushroom, or trouser topper). Ensure the machine features adjustable pressure settings and a vacuum suction function to quickly cool and set the fabric shape. High-quality models should utilize stainless steel or polished chrome surfaces to prevent rust and fabric snagging, and incorporate dual-button safety controls to protect operators' hands during the pressing cycle.

How do I ensure the machine complies with international safety and quality standards?

For cross-border procurement, verify that the equipment carries CE marking (for Europe) or UL certification (for North America). Since these machines involve high pressure and steam, compliance with the Pressure Equipment Directive (PED) or ASME standards for steam boilers is critical. Always request ISO 9001 certification from the manufacturer to ensure consistent production quality and ask for test reports regarding electromagnetic compatibility (EMC) if the machine features digital PLC control systems.

What are the requirements for installation and operational environment?

Dry cleaning pressing machines require a stable industrial power supply (typically 3-phase 380V) and a dedicated compressed air connection (0.6-0.8 MPa) for pneumatic models. You must ensure your facility has an adequate ventilation system to manage heat and moisture exhaust. Additionally, check if the machine has a built-in steam generator or if it requires a connection to a centralized boiler system, as this significantly impacts your initial setup costs and floor space requirements.

How can I evaluate the durability and maintenance needs of the equipment?

Look for machines with heavy-duty cast iron frames to minimize vibration and ensure long-term alignment. The padding and cover cloth should be made of high-temperature resistant materials like Nomex or silicone, which typically last for 2,000+ pressing hours. Ask the supplier about the availability of wear parts (valves, gaskets, and springs) and ensure they provide a detailed maintenance manual and a minimum 12-month warranty on core pneumatic and heating components.

Cross-Border Procurement & Risk Management for Industrial Machinery

What are the primary risks when importing heavy laundry machinery and how can they be mitigated?

The main risks include shipping damage and technical non-conformity. To mitigate these, insist on seaworthy vacuum packaging with moisture-proof barriers and wooden crate reinforcement. It is highly recommended to hire a third-party inspector to verify the voltage configuration and steam pressure tests before the machine leaves the factory.

How should I negotiate with suppliers to get the best value for bulk or specialized orders?

Focus on the Total Cost of Ownership (TCO) rather than just the unit price. Negotiate for spare parts kits (valves, pads, hoses) to be included in the initial price, which can save 5-10% in future maintenance costs. For orders of multiple units, request a volume discount of 10-15% and ask the supplier to provide video installation guides or remote technical training as part of the after-sales package.

What are the essential shipping and customs considerations for this product category?

Dry cleaning machines are heavy and classified under HS Code 845130 (Ironing machines and presses). Ensure the supplier provides a Certificate of Origin to potentially reduce import duties under Free Trade Agreements. Because of the weight, FOB (Free On Board) is often preferred so you can control the ocean freight costs. Ensure the wood packaging materials (WPM) are treated and marked according to ISPM 15 standards to avoid customs delays or fines at the destination port.
